Osage County, Oklahoma — FY2024

← Back to all years

In fiscal year 2024, Osage County, Oklahoma received $4.8M across 262 payment records. That is $105.03 per resident based on Census Bureau population estimates. ▼ 68.3% vs. FY2023

Programs in FY2024

Rank Program Total Records
1 LIVESTOCK FORAGE PROGRAM-2014 FARM BILL 10.109 $2,626K 128
2 DISCRIMINATION FINANCIAL ASSISTANCE PROGRAM 10.984 $1,574K 58
3 RURAL RENTAL ASSISTANCE PAYMENTS 10.427 $581K 2
4 AGRICULTURE RISK COVERAGE PROGRAM 10.113 $35K 62
5 PANDEMIC ASSISTANCE REVENUE PROGRAM 10.143 $16K 5
6 NONINSURED ASSISTANCE 10.451 $6K 1
7 CONSERVATION RESERVE PROGRAM 10.069 $3K 1
8 EMERGENCY ASSISTANCE FOR LIVESTOCK, HONEYBEES AND FARM-RAISED FISH PROGRAM-2014 FARM BILL 10.110 $3K 1
9 PRICE LOSS COVERAGE 10.112 $1K 4
